Know-How and Skills

First off, you want a team that knows their stuff. They should be wizards with PHP, JavaScript, HTML, and CSS—these are the building blocks of WordPress plugins. Plus, they should get WordPress inside out, from its core to its APIs and coding rules.

Contract and Agreement Terms

Once you’ve set your expectations, it’s time to get into the contract. No matter how much you trust the company, read the contract. It should clearly outline the cost, deliverables, timelines, and terms for any revisions or cancellations.

Check if the company offers post-development support or maintenance services. This is crucial to keep your plugin up-to-date and running smoothly.

Pay close attention to the intellectual property clause. Ideally, you want full ownership of the developed plugin.

Managing the Project and Setting Deadlines

Managing the project and setting deadlines are also crucial when working with a WordPress plugin development company. They should give you a clear timeline with milestones and deadlines.

A detailed project plan helps you know what to expect at each stage of development. It also keeps the company on track to deliver the project on time.

Here’s an example of a project timeline:

PhaseTasksDuration
DiscoveryGathering requirements, Planning1-2 weeks
DesignWireframing, UI/UX design2-3 weeks
DevelopmentCoding, Integration4-6 weeks
TestingQuality assurance, Bug fixing2-3 weeks
DeploymentLaunch, Support1 week
